Seite 1 von 2
Externe MySql Datenbank
Verfasst: 04.05.2004 14:49
von trekgate
Hi,
nachdem ich die Suchfunktion benutzt und vergeblich nach einer Antwort auf meine Frage gesucht habe, werde ich diese nun hier kurz erleutern.
Da ich mein phpBB Forum auf einen anderen Webspace verlegen will, habe eine externe MySQL 4.x Datenbank. Leider kann ich zu dieser nicht connecten. Ich habe bereits den dbinformer.php ausgeführt. Mit folgender Meldung:
- You have not established a connection to MySQL 4.x.
ERROR: Can't connect to local MySQL server through socket '/var/lib/mysql/mysql.sock' (2)
Your database was not found.
ERROR: Can't connect to local MySQL server through socket '/var/lib/mysql/mysql.sock' (2)
Ich habe die IP des Servers mit http:// und ohne eingegeben, jedoch brachte es keinen Unterschied.
Was mach ich falsch ?
Verfasst: 04.05.2004 15:03
von D@ve
Viele Hoster erlauben nur einen Datenbankzugriff von dem eigenen Server aus, was wahrscheinlich auch bei Dir die Ursache des Problems ist.
Normalerweise sollte es kein Problem sein, ich machs bei mir teilweise auch so, dass ich wenn ich neue Templates erstelle, die lokal bei mir auf dem Rechner habe, aber die DBs von meinen laufenden Boards nehme.
Gruß, Dave
Verfasst: 04.05.2004 15:06
von trekgate
Ich habe extra noch in die FAQ von dem Hoster geguckt (
www.yoursql.de). Externe Zugriffe sind erlaubt.
Verfasst: 04.05.2004 15:19
von D@ve
Bist Du sicher, dass Du alles richtig eingegeben hast? Db-Name, Server, Passwort und Port?
Gruß, Dave
Verfasst: 04.05.2004 20:40
von trekgate
Ich habe das angeben, was mir mein Anbieter an Daen geschickt hat. Von Port war dort jedoch nicht die Rede.
Hier der Fehler, der auftritt:
- Warning: mysql_connect(): Host 'sls-cd9p12.dca2.superb.net' is blocked because of many connection errors. Unblock with 'mysqladmin flush-hosts' in /home/pille/public_html/Board/db/mysql4.php on line 48
Warning: mysql_error(): supplied argument is not a valid MySQL-Link resource in /home/pille/public_html/Board/db/mysql4.php on line 330
Warning: mysql_errno(): supplied argument is not a valid MySQL-Link resource in /home/pille/public_html/Board/db/mysql4.php on line 331
phpBB : Kritischer Fehler
Could not connect to the database
Verfasst: 04.05.2004 20:52
von chewy
du mußt sehen das der server auf dem deine sql liegt auf die du zugreifen willst wildcards erlaubt. dann gibste da die ip oder den namen deines servers an auf dem dein board liegt das auf die sql zugreifen soll.
greetz
Verfasst: 04.05.2004 20:55
von trekgate
Ist mir peinlich zu fragen :Was sind / ist Wildcarts bzw. wo kann ich dieses Feature finden ?
Verfasst: 04.05.2004 21:18
von chewy
es gibt keine peinlichen oder dumme Fragen

wer was wissen möchte muß fragen oder ?
log dich mal ins confixx oder kas oder cpanel oder was auch immer du hast ein und geh mal auf mysql und such mal wo du diese einstellung findest. im cpanel findest du sie ganz unten wenn du auf mysql geklickt hast: wildcards erlauben , und da trägst du dann den server ein von dem aus zugegriffen werden soll.wie das bei confixx ist hab ich vergessen

) aber da gibt da diese funktion auch
und nicht vergessen die config.php entsprechend anzupassen

Verfasst: 04.05.2004 21:21
von trekgate
Ich kann mich nur ins phpMyAdmin 2.5.6 einloggen. Mehr hab ich nicht.
Verfasst: 04.05.2004 21:24
von D@ve
Mal ne andere Frage: Hast Du mal versucht mit einem lokal installierten phpMyAdmin auf die DB zuzugreifen? Das Script ist da normalerweise nicht ganz so zimperlich wie phpBB...
Wildcards heißt zu "deutsch" nichts anders als Joker. Sprich Du hast Zeichen die Du für andere einsetzen kannst. Das Sternchen ist zB eines der bekanntesten Wildcards. Wenn Du zB. in der Suche nach *.bat suchst suchst Du nach allen Dateien mit der Endung bat.
Gruß, Dave